Most replacement home buttons won’t work, so check carefully before starting your repair. Your iPhone’s original home button is uniquely paired to the logic board at the factory-and without Apple’s proprietary calibration process, even a genuine replacement home button from another iPhone won’t work. To fix a broken home button, you should install a specially-made, universal-style home button. #ALPHABABY REVIEW APP IPHONE HOME BUTTON INSTALL# Note that these replacements only work as a button Touch ID will not function. If you are only replacing a broken screen, you can use this guide to carefully remove and transfer your working original home button to a new screen, preserving all functions, including Touch ID.ĭuring this procedure, to avoid accidentally straining or tearing the display cables, it's best to completely detach the display assembly before beginning repairs on the home/Touch ID sensor. But if you are comfortable doing so, you may skip the display assembly section of this guide and go straight to the home/Touch ID sensor section.One of the subtlest features of an iPhone is that it taps or vibrates when you perform certain actions, like using the flashlight or changing the settings. These taps are called haptic feedback and they’re generated by the Taptic Engine. The iPhone 7 was the first model to include haptic feedback, which used it to simulate a physical click on its non-mechanical Home button. Newer iPhones and iOS releases expanded on haptic feedback with Haptic Touch. This feature lets you peek at documents or access quick action menus as well.

As the taste intensifies, a surprising hint of apricot lingers beneath the flavors of honey, cinnamon, allspice, clove, and mint. On the palate, there are light indications of spice. There are charred caramel, oak, and honey notes on the nose. The color of the spirit is a toasty amber. This forces the whiskey into the barrel’s wood, absorbing more flavor qualities.Īlthough the whiskey appears to be going through a rigorous process, the flavor is far from robust. The distinctive music of Metallica jolts the whiskey back from the dead after combining in the black brandy casks by being pounded by low-hertz soundwaves as part of a specialized sonic-enhancement method. Each type of whiskey has a distinct flavor that contributes significantly to the final product’s rich and distinctive flavors. This artistic whiskey combines the finest whiskeys, bourbons, and ryes, personally handpicked by master distiller Dave Pickerell. The whiskey is pounded by low hertz vibrations using Metallica’s specialized sonic-enhancement system, which causes it to penetrate and seep deeper into the barrel to absorb more flavors from the wood during the distilling process. BLACKENED Whiskey is a re-mastered American whiskey that signifies a groundbreaking artistic partnership between Rock and Roll Hall of Fame rock band Metallica and Hall of Fame Master Distiller Dave Pickerell. |
